分享

对于安装官方的AdobeReader出现"expr: 写入时发生错误"问题的解决方案

 aquamarine 2007-04-29

安装官方acroread之后,启动没反应。终端启动,循环输出: expr: 写入时发生问题

原因:/usr/lib/libgtk-x11-2.so.0.1000.6版本的变化,原本可以匹配的语句不能正确的匹配到此文件。

解决办法:

编辑安装目录下的bin/acroread

找到:

echo $mfile| sed ‘s/libgtk-x11-\([0-9]*\).0.so.0.\([0-9]\)00.\([0-9]*\)\|\(.*\)/\1\2\3/g‘

改为:

echo $mfile| sed ‘s/libgtk-x11-\([0-9]*\).0.so.0.\([0-9]*\)00.\([0-9]*\)\|\(.*\)/\1\2\3/g‘

即在第二个[0-9]后边加上一个*。

另外,对于使用scim没有用scim-bridge的,还需要在这个文件的开始#!/bin/bash下边加上一行

export GTK_IM_ MODULE=xim

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多